10 MAY 1822
Melancholy occurrence –
Thomas WARK from Beith found dead on muir between Largs and Kilmacolm. Missing for three weeks, found Wed 1st. Interred in
Largs.
31 MAY 1822
Notice to Creditors. Invite
for claims on the estate of the deceased David PATERSON to be lodged. Resident at Largs, then Dumfin, Dumbartonshire.
21 JUN 1822
Pickpockets at Largs Fair
caught. Gang of 16 pickpockets caught on steamboat at fair.

21 JUL 1826
Drowning accident. Mr. GLEN,
farmer in Largs – drowned on boat ferrying passengers to George IV steam boat. Other victims: Mr. HERVEY from Dalry,
Mr. ORR, farmer near Beith, Mr GENMILL, confectioner in Paisley.
